Overview

The BasX A2 is a two-channel power amplifier that delivers 160 watts/channel into 8 Ohms and 250 watts/channel into 4 Ohms, with a rated THD+N of < 0.02%, and an A-weighted S/N ratio of 112 dB. The BasX A2 features a heavy-duty linear power supply, high-quality Class A/B amplification, transparent fault protection, and a trigger input and output. The BasX A2 also offers a convenient feature that allows the amp to switch on when an audio signal is detected at its input, which is especially useful if your preamp or receiver doesn’t offer a trigger output. High-quality industry-standard unbalanced RCA inputs enable the BasX A2 to be used with almost any preamp or processor, and audiophile-grade five-way speaker terminals accept banana plugs, spade lugs, or bare wire. These features combine to enable the BasX A2 to deliver true audiophile performance and sound quality at an amazingly affordable price.

The BasX A2 is the ideal amplifier to serve as the foundation of a great-sounding stereo system, to power the front main speakers on a surround sound system, or to upgrade the front left and right channels of your favorite surround sound receiver.

 

Specifications

Circuit Topology

The BasX A2 is a stereo power amplifier. The BasX A2 combines classical audiophile amplifier architecture, based on a heavy-duty linear power supply, and a carefully designed high current short signal path Class A/B output stage, with advanced microprocessor-controlled monitoring and protection circuitry, to deliver superb sound quality at a truly reasonable price.

Audio Specifications

Power Output
(Two Channels Driven) 160 watts RMS per channel; 20 Hz – 20 kHz; THD < 0.1%; into 8 Ohms. 250 watts RMS
per channel
1 kHz; THD < 1%; into 4 Ohms.
Power Bandwidth (at rated power; 4 Ohm – 8 Ohm load)
20 Hz to 20 kHz (+ / – 0.07 dB)
Broad Band Frequency Response
10 Hz to 80 kHz +0/-1.8 dB
THD + noise
< 0.02% (A-weighted); ref rated power
Signal to Noise Ratio (8 Ohm load)
> 112 dB; ref rated power; (A-weighted).
Minimum Recommended Load Impedance (per channel)
4 Ohms (which equals one 4 Ohm load or two paralleled 8 Ohm loads).
Damping Factor (8 Ohm load)
> 500.
Input Sensitivity (for rated power; 8 Ohm load)
1.2 V.
Gain
29 dB.
Input Impedance
27 kOhms.
